This book is a classical study of the human mind and how it works in its relationship with values and belief systems. Exercises are provided so that values can be tested and physical powers developed. The human equation teaches you how to effectively handle stress, anxiety, tension, and problems.

The author of the Human Equation is Sensei Kirk Ellis. He began his philosophical training in 1960 with the martial arts. He holds a third-degree black belt in judo and a fifth-degree belt in karate. Since 1972, he has used the philosophical concepts of the martial arts to teach self-improvement programs, management trainings, and special metaphysical seminars. As a teacher, psychology major, and martial artist, he combined the Eastern and Western philosophies and created philosophical popa new style of music. Currently, he directs the black belt training program for Kenju Studios, which he founded. He gives self-improvement seminars and lectures.
